Is Vista a bad area?

Is Vista a bad area?

The chance of becoming a victim of either violent or property crime in Vista is 1 in 55. Based on FBI crime data, Vista is not one of the safest communities in America. Relative to California, Vista has a crime rate that is higher than 44\% of the state’s cities and towns of all sizes.

Is it safe to live in Vista California?

Vista is in the 33rd percentile for safety, meaning 67\% of cities are safer and 33\% of cities are more dangerous. The rate of crime in Vista is 34.64 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in Vista generally consider the southwest part of the city to be the safest.

Does Vista CA have the best weather?

The annual BestPlaces Comfort Index for Vista is 9.1 (10=best), which means it is one of the most pleasant places in California. June, October and September are the most pleasant months in Vista, while January and February are the least comfortable months.

What is Vista California known for?

Vista is a city of about 100,000 residents located 15 miles inland from the iconic Pacific coast towns of Carlsbad and Oceanside. Vista is known for its abundant microbreweries, restaurants, shopping attractions, and theaters. Some of the state’s most scenic beaches are just a few minutes away as well.

How hot does Vista CA get?

46°F to 79°F
Climate and Average Weather Year Round in Vista California, United States. In Vista, the summers are warm, arid, and clear and the winters are long, cool, and partly cloudy. Over the course of the year, the temperature typically varies from 46°F to 79°F and is rarely below 39°F or above 85°F.

Why is San Diego so cool?

San Diego has a marine climate, strongly influenced by cool Pacific Ocean temperatures that annually range from the upper 50s to upper 60s. As the cool ocean air spreads inland it gradually warms, with much higher temperatures in the inland valleys.

Where is Vista California located?

Vista (/ˈvɪstə/; Spanish: view) is a city in Southern California and is located in northwestern San Diego County. Vista is a medium-sized city within the San Diego-Carlsbad, CA Metropolitan Area and has a population of 101,659.

What city is Vista CA in?

Vista is a city in north San Diego County, California. It was incorporated January 28, 1963 and became a charter city on June 13, 2007. Located just seven miles inland from the Pacific Ocean in northern San Diego County, the City of Vista has a Mediterranean climate.
